Pricing: Platformatic vs Next.js
| Plan | Platformatic | Next.js |
|---|---|---|
| Tier 1 | Free Open Source Toolkit | $0 Next.js (Open Source) |
| Tier 2 | N/A | $0 Vercel Hobby (Free) |
| Tier 3 | N/A | $20 Vercel Pro |
| Tier 4 | N/A | Custom Vercel Enterprise |
Pricing verified from each vendor's public pricing page. Compare in detail on Platformatic pricing and Next.js pricing.
